Digital Addressable System definition

Digital Addressable System means an electronic device (which includes hardware and its associated software) or more than one electronic device put in an integrated system through which signals of the Cable Television Network can be sent by the DPO to its subscriber in an encrypted form, which can be decoded by the device or devices, having an activated CAS at the premises of the subscriber within limits of the authorization made, through the CAS and the SMS, on the explicit choice and request of such subscriber.

  • As television homes increase going forward, consumer demand for content beyond free to air channels, combined with the relatively low ARPUs are expected to drive the demand for C&S in India.- Distribution: Digitization - the game changer: The cable television industry in India is poised for one of its most significant developments in the last decade- a transformation to the Digital Addressable System (DAS) for television distribution.

  • The year 2012 heralded perhaps the most significant development in the last decade for the cable television industry with the roll out of the mandatory Digital Addressable System (DAS).
